  2. Google Maps will now begin providing turn-by-turn directions to your destination. 7. Turn on Voice Guidance. To turn on voice guidance, tap on the volume control button located at the bottom of the screen. This will bring up a menu with various options for controlling the sound on your device. Tap on the “Voice Guidance” option to turn it on.

  7. Simply pair your phone with Bluetooth. Enter the menu on your Toyota to do this. Select Bluetooth after choosing Setup. Open your phone and, from the list of available devices, choose your car. After doing this, you can use the Google Maps app on your phone to route your routes through the speakers in your car!
